California’s Beverly Hills Epitomizes Upscale Travel by Lee Foster Travel in the United States has become decidedly upscale, for some. Observers of travel have watched as this measurable trend developed. For a small, but identifiable segment of travelers, price is no object. What is of concern is the highest quality in accommodations, dining, and experience. This is the traveler whom every destination now seeks to woo. For the majority of travelers, reports on this privileged minority amount to armchair or fantasy travel, an act of vicarious gratification. Nowhere in the U.S. is the phenomenon of upscale travel better expressed than in Beverly Hills , CA . This writer on one occasion immersed himself in this elite travel environment. It is fitting that here the movie industry, the makers of illusion, also finds its home. Beverly Hills passed its 90th birthday in 2004 and headed confidently towards 100. The old gal isn’t allowing herself to show her age, of course, because plenty of cosmetic surgery is ongoing in the hotels, shops, and restaurants. “We see ourselves as an oasis where the traveler can find the highest quality goods, the best hotels and restaurants, and the ultimate in service,” said the Beverly Hills ‘ mayor. LODGINGS: STARTING AT RAFFLES L’ERMITAGE Raffles L’Ermitage Hotel in Beverly Hills may well be the choicest lodging in America . Such objective observers as AAA and Mobil have awarded it their coveted five star/diamond ratings, which are tough to get and rarely coincide in one property. L’Ermitage enjoys plenty of competition in Beverly Hills from the Beverly Hills Hotel, Regent Beverly Wilshire, and Beverly Hilton. -

Silverton family honors a legacy of Food and Community Page 1 of 5 Categories: COVER STORY Date: Jun 19, 2008 Title: Silverton family honors a legacy of Food and Community BY PAULINE ADAMEK Silverton family honors a legacy of Food and Community The Silverton family legacy connects food and community (R-L: Gail Silverton, Andreas Krankl, Larry Silverton,Nancy Silverton, Joel Gutman). www.robertevans.com Silverton family honors a legacy of Food and Community BY PAULINE ADAMEK The story of the Silverton family is a fascinating tale of how many successful businesses have been developed and nurtured, creating a legacy that entwines food with community. Importantly, these enterprises are driven more by heart than by fiscal reward, and reap greater successes than anyone had anticipated. This tale starts with a benevolent patriarch, Lawrence S. Silverton. A construction lawsuit-attorney, savvy businessman, real estate tycoon and coffee, calligraphy and motorcycle enthusiast, Larry used his business acumen and support to enable his two daughters, Nancy and Gail, to make an indelible mark on the Los Angeles landscape and beyond. Now he’s assisting his six grandchildren in their studies and burgeoning business enterprises. Larry Silverton’s Story: Born in South Dakota, Larry moved to Sherman Oaks and started a family with his wife, Doris. When most mothers in the 1950s were taking advantage of labor-saving technologies, Doris, a journalist and writer, taught her daughters the goodness of lentils, goat’s cheese and a beautifully set table. This gave the Silverton sisters an appreciation of the heart and hearth of family and a desire, later, to create a product and environment that could contribute to the community. -

Wine Institute of California [email protected] CALIFORNIA-STYLE WINE COUNTRY RESTAURANTS & FARMERS’ MARKETS A Regional Focus on Enjoying the Artisan Food Trend with Local California Wines The popularity of California wine, fresh produce and regional cuisine continues to expand worldwide. For travelers to the state, one of the best ways to discover what’s new in fresh seasonal cooking and dining is to visit California’s wine country. Local restaurants focus on pairing regional wines with natural, farm-grown ingredients, often sourced from community farmers’ markets. These markets reflect the abundance of produce available in the state, as California is America’s top agricultural state, producing 400 plant and animal commodities. There are more than 400 certified farmers’ markets throughout California, many of them in the state’s wine regions. A complete listing is available at http://www.cafarmersmarkets.com. Mirroring the growth in California wineries, California farmers’ markets have continued to rise in popularity over the past three decades. Professional chefs shop alongside domestic consumers, looking for field-ripened fruits and vegetables, fragrant flowers, fresh fish, artisan breads and pastries, plus delicacies such as local olive oils and cheeses. Beginning in 2000, California wine can now be sold at qualified California Certified Farmers’ Markets. Restaurants and consumers alike are aware that more flavorful dishes can be created with heirloom vegetables and products, grown, raised or harvested with the same care that is put into their preparation. Food from local sources also travels from the farm to the plate in a timely manner. The freshness of the ingredients becomes part of the feature of the dish and supports the sustainable concept of “green dining” in that less fossil fuel is used to transport products from the farm to the kitchen. -

Pizzeria Mozza Introduction Pizzeria Mozza is almost exactly the same as its flagship outlet in California, with the delicious addition of local seafood and vegetables. Located next to its fine dining sister Osteria Mozza at Marina Bay Sands, Pizzeria is a bustling, urban burst of flavour and colour, presenting a casual dining environment amid upbeat rock music. The highlight of Pizzeria’s menu is the hand-crafted artisanal pizzas prepared daily, fresh from two wood burning pizza ovens in a lively display kitchen– the energy centre of the main dining hall. Opened everyday from 12 noon onwards, Pizzeria welcomes families, business lunchers, foodies, pizza mavens, dough-obsessed bloggers, wine geeks, and late-night clubgoers with enthusiasm. The wine bar offers a selection of 100 Italian wines all under $100. In addition to its world-famous pizzas, some of Pizzeria’s other signature menu items include crispy Duck legs with lentils, Lasagna al forno, and Nancy’s legendary Chopped Salad. Must-try desserts include its homemade Sorbetti, Gelati and Butterscotch Budino. Pizzeria Mozza also offers Meatless Monday specials as part of a global movement for health and environmental benefits. On Mondays, the restaurant serves a series of wholesome wood-fired oven roasted vegetables and grilled cheese sandwiches. The Team Nancy Silverton Nancy Silverton is the co-owner of Pizzeria and Osteria Mozza in Los Angeles, Newport Beach and Singapore, as well as Mozza2Go and Chi Spacca in Los Angeles. Silverton also founded the world- renowned La Brea Bakery and Campanile Restaurant. Throughout her celebrated career, Silverton has worked with some of the nation’s most notable chefs including Jimmy Brinkley at Michael’s Restaurant.
